beka

BE-ka

borrow

Generalverb

French: emprunter

Nalingi kobeka mbongo.

I want to borrow money.

Je veux emprunter de l'argent.

To borrow — a small trust between neighbours. Kobeka (also kodefa) is to borrow. In close-knit compounds, borrowing salt, money or a tool is everyday, and repaying it well keeps the web of trust intact.
